About William P. Vostrejs

William P. Vostrejs is a scholar working on Hepatology, Biotechnology and Oncology, having authored 4 papers that have together received 20 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(1 paper),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(1 paper) and RNA modifications and cancer (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Oncology (10 citations), Sensory Systems (1 citation) and Cancer Research (3 citations). William P. Vostrejs has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Rina Sor, Nataliya Tovbis Shifrin, Ben Z. Stanger, Amy Cooke, Nune Markosyan, Mallika Singh, Elsa Quintana, Robert H. Vonderheide, Il‐Kyu Kim and Adam B. Kramer.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Cancer Discovery and JCI Insight.
